City College of San Francisco is in San Francisco, CA.
During the most recent reporting year, 65 automotive mechanics technology degrees were granted at City College of San Francisco.
Studying Online at City College of San Francisco
Many students take online classes at City College of San Francisco. Of 19,267 students, 5,361 (28%) studied exclusively online and 5,451 (28%) took at least some classes online.
Student Demographics & Diversity
Take a look at the composition of Automotive Mechanics Technology graduates at City College of San Francisco, by degree type.
Looking at the program as a whole, Automotive Mechanics Technology graduates at City College of San Francisco are 5% women (3) and 95% men (62).
Automotive Mechanics Technology Associate’s Program at City College of San Francisco
Of the 9 associate’s automotive mechanics technology graduates at City College of San Francisco, 11% were women (1) and 89% were men (8).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Automotive Mechanics Technology associate’s degree recipients at City College of San Francisco.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 1 |
| Hispanic / Latino | 2 |
| Asian | 3 |
| Two or More Races | 2 |
| Unknown | 1 |
Racial-ethnic minorities make up 78% of Automotive Mechanics Technology associate’s degree recipients at City College of San Francisco, above the national average of 55%.*
*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
Highest-Paying Careers for Automotive Mechanics Technology Graduates
Students who finish Automotive Mechanics Technology program at City College of San Francisco pursue many career paths. Below are the top-paying careers for Automotive Mechanics Technology graduates, ordered by median annual salary:
| Occupation | Nationwide Median Wage |
|---|---|
| Electrical and Electronics Installers and Repairers, Transportation Equipment | $63,098 |
| Electronic Equipment Installers and Repairers, Motor Vehicles | $61,541 |
| Automotive Service Technicians and Mechanics | $40,917 |
